前端

前后端怎么交互

浏览器发送一个请求到后端,后端处理逻辑,把结果(HTML文本)返回给浏览器。

前端

HTML 骨架 内容

css 样式

js 动态效果

HTML 超文本标记语言

标记 标签

分类

单边标记双边标记

head

编码 关键字 描述 标题的内容 link style script body

内联(行内)标签

字体
加粗 b strong
斜体 i em
上下标 sup sub
中划线 下划线 del s u



页面显示的内容
href: 链接地址
锚点: #id
target:打开方式
_blank: 新建一个窗口
_self: 当前窗口
title: 鼠标悬浮上显示的标题

src: 网络地址、本地地址(相对路径、绝对路径)
alt : 链接地址有问题时提示的内容
title: 鼠标悬浮上显示的标题
width: 设置图片的宽度
height:设置图片的高度
width和height选择一个
特殊字符:

&nbsp: 空格

块级标签

​ h1 - h6

今日内容

块级标签

排版标签

p:一个文本级别的段落标签 前后有间距

P标签中不嵌套其他的块级标签

div 没有任何样式的块级标签

hr 分割线

列表

无序列表

type="原点的样式"

  • 手机
  • 电脑
  • iPad
  • 手机
  • 电脑
  • iPad
  • 手机
  • 电脑
  • iPad
  • 手机
  • 电脑
  • iPad
有序列表

type="数字的样式" start =“起始值”(数字)

  1. 手机
  2. 电脑
  3. iPad
  1. 手机
  2. 电脑
  3. iPad
  1. 手机
  2. 电脑
  3. iPad
  1. 手机
  2. 电脑
  3. iPad
  1. 手机
  2. 电脑
  3. iPad
定义列表

dt 标题

dd 内容

城市
北京
上海
深圳
<dt>城市</dt>
<dd>北京</dd>
<dd>上海</dd>
<dd>深圳</dd>
表格
</tr>
<tr align="center" valign="top">
    <td>2</td>
    <td >alex</td>


</tr>
<tr>
    <td>2</td>
    <td>wusir</td>
    <td rowspan="2">2208</td>

</tr>
</tbody>
序号 姓名 年龄
1 alex 84
<tbody>
<tr align="center" valign="bottom">
    <td>1</td>
    <td >alex</td>
    <td >84</td>


</tr>
<tr align="center" valign="top">
    <td>2</td>
    <td >alex</td>


</tr>
<tr>
    <td>2</td>
    <td>wusir</td>
    <td rowspan="2">2208</td>

</tr>
</tbody>
表单

rap 篮球 label



其他的input






select option

上传文件 CSS

引入方式

Title
<!--内联引入-->
<style>
    div {
        color: #ffef6b
    }

</style>

<!--外联引入:链接  使用较多  -->
    <link rel="stylesheet" href="index.css">
<!--外联引入:导入-->
<style>
    @import url('index.css');
</style>
黄焖鸡米饭
黄焖鸡排骨
简单的样式

color: #ffef6b; /字体颜色/
200px; /宽度/
height: 200px; /高度/
background: blue; /背景颜色/
选择器

基本选择器

标签id类通用选择器

黄焖鸡米饭 米饭 外卖连接
黄焖鸡排骨 排骨 米饭
米饭
原文地址:https://www.cnblogs.com/x-h-15029451788/p/11644153.html